Passive genotype–environment correlation refers to the association between the genotype a child inherits from his or her parents and the environment in which the child is raised. Parents create a home environment that is influenced by their own heritable characteristics.

The term <span>argumentativeness is mostly used to describe someone's willingness to confront a different opinion/approach.
The confrontation for this matter doesn't necessarily have to be vicious or destructive and could be done through a rational and open-minded approach.</span>
